Documented effects: Superior anti-inflammatory effects; Enhanced cardiovascular protection; Prostate health support; Nitrogen radical scavenging. More effective than alpha-tocopherol at reducing inflammation
The common daily range is 100-400 mg. By goal — maintenance: 100-200 mg; therapeutic: 200-600 mg; cardiovascular: 200-400 mg daily; combination: Often used with 100-400 IU alpha-tocopherol.
With fat containing meal. First effects are typically reported within 2-4 weeks for anti-inflammatory and antioxidant benefits.
At excessive doses: No known toxicity at supplemental doses, Potential displacement of alpha-tocopherol, May enhance anticoagulant effects, Generally excellent safety profile, No established upper limit. Safety rating at normal doses is 8 out of 10.
Separate it from Alpha Tocopherol High Dose, Iron Excess by two to four hours. High alpha-tocopherol may reduce gamma-tocopherol levels
Documented interactions with anticoagulants-warfarin, chemotherapy-agents, statins. Discuss these with a pharmacist before combining.
The tolerable upper intake level is 1000 mg per day for adults, per NIH ODS. Above that, the risk of adverse effects rises: No known toxicity at supplemental doses, Potential displacement of alpha-tocopherol, May enhance anticoagulant effects.
The marker is Plasma gamma-tocopherol levels, optimal range Variable, higher levels associated with benefits. Common deficiency signs: Increased inflammation markers, Enhanced oxidative stress, Poor cardiovascular health markers, Elevated nitrogen radical damage.
